Police Killer Sentenced to Death

A man who killed a policeman in July was sentenced to death on 4th by the Beijing No.1 Intermediate People's Court.

Wang Guoqing, 22, Li Zhongbao, 26, and Li Deyu, 30, plotted to steal from tourists in the Summer Palace on July 23 this year.

Wang and Li Zhongbao stole a mobile phone from a tourist. Policeman Yuan Shiguang detected their pilferage and tried to seize them with two other volunteers.

Wang broke the main artery in the abdomen of Yuan with a knife.The fatal wound led to the death of the policeman.

During the interrogation, Wang confessed that he had killed another man surnamed Zhu, on July 4, during a quarrel. Before being arrested, the three had also stolen a mobile phone, a camera and a telescope.��

Wang was sentenced to death and was deprived of political rights with all his private property confiscated.

Li Zhongbao was sentenced to six months of imprisonment and was fined 1,000 yuan. His help in the tracing and arrest of Wang was taken into consideration for his sentencing.

Li Deyu was sentenced to 15 months of imprisonment and was fined 2,000 yuan for helping Wang sell the stolen goods.
